LPN/RN Unit Manager
On-siteDurham, North Carolina, United States
Job Summary
Oversee daily clinical operations of the assigned nursing unit, supervising staff and CNAs while ensuring resident care aligns with individualized care plans. Complete assessments, documentation, and charting accurately; monitor resident conditions and communicate updates to physicians and families. Participate in care plan meetings, assist with admissions and discharges, and ensure compliance with federal and state regulations. Promote a positive team environment and commit to the weekend on-call rotation. This role offers mentorship and pathways to Director of Nursing or Administrator positions within Carver Living Center, with competitive pay and same-day pay available.
Required Qualifications
- Current, active North Carolina LPN or RN license
- Weekend On-Call Rotation Required
Desired Qualifications
- Previous skilled nursing or long-term care experience preferred
- Prior leadership or supervisory experience preferred
- Strong clinical assessment and communication skills
- Excellent organizational, leadership, and problem-solving abilities
- Passion for providing exceptional care and developing others
